Macedonian Kingdom. Alexander III the Great. 336-323 B.C. AR drachm (18.2 mm, 4.11 g, 1 h). Uncertain mint in Greece or Macedon, struck ca. 310-275 B.C. Head of Herakles right, wearing lion's skin headdress / AΛEΞANΔPOY, Zeus seated left on throne, holding eagle and scepter; aphlaston in left field. Price 862; Müller 283. aVF.
